"Billy" Lovingood died on July 30, 2011 at Chapel Hill, North Carolina, at age 79.3,2 He Chapel Hill - Dr. Bill Lovingood died Saturday, July 30, 2011 after waging a courageous battle against esophageal cancer. As per his wishes he died at his home, surrounded by family and friends. Bill was born in Murphy, North Carolina on September 20, 1931, the first of Edith and Wade Lovingood's nine children. He was a standout athlete in the western part of our state and was awarded a full athletic scholarship to Wake Forest University. Before leaving for his freshman year, he and his bride to be, Sally Belle Ferguson eloped, and were married in the Sylva courthouse. Bill's time at Wake was bisected by four years in the Navy, served aboard the minesweeper U.S.S. Aggressive. Following the service to his Country he returned to Winston-Salem, earning his B.S. degree and rounding out his athletic career. As a starting pitcher, he went undefeated in 1957 and posted a 0.58 earned run average, an A.C.C. record that still stands. He came to Chapel Hill in 1958 to begin his post-graduate studies, and went on to earn MPH and PhD degrees from the University of North Carolina. He accepted a teaching position in the Physical Education department at the time and remained there until his retirement in 1988. Thousands of Tarheel students over four decades enjoyed his popular lecture courses. From the early Sixties until the mid Seventies he served as Carolina's assistant baseball coach under his good friend Walt Rabb. Football Saturdays were always spent in Kenan Stadium where Dad worked to facilitate the concession sales. He also found time to coach many seasons in the Chapel Hill recreation department where he left a lasting impression on a generation of local kids. Dad's youth, spent largely in the Smoky Mountains hunting and fishing with numerous uncles, cousins and brothers fostered in him a lifelong love of all things outdoors. He loved to bird hunt with his buddies in the athletic department and the Rams Club. He never met a stranger, and would go fishing with anyone he could persuade to join him. Stories of missed shots or "the one that got away" made up the bulk of conversation when he met with buddies at Merritt's, Knight & Campbell or later in life, Johnny's Sporting Goods. "Doc" Lovingood was a man who was large in stature and had an even larger love of life. He will be sorely missed by all who knew him. We love you dad.
